#720b30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#720b30 is composed of 44.7% red, 4.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 338.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 24.5%. #720b30 color hex could be obtained by blending #e41660 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#720b30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070103 is the darkest color, while #fef4f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#720b30

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#423b3e is the less saturated color, while #7c012d is the most saturated one.
